WINGHEAD B41
Ultra High-Resolution Curved Array Bathymetric System.
NORBIT introduces the first cylindrical ultra-high resolution curved array bathymetric system, designed for rapid anywhere anytime mobilisation.
Description
The WINGHEAD series is the most compact sonar designed for use on all platforms including subsea ROVs and AUVs. With low power consumption, the system is suitable to operate from a battery. NORBIT’s wideband Multibeam technology facilitates long-range real-time data collection and at the same time achieves high-resolution data.
The WINGHEAD sonars are based on a state-of-the-art analogue and digital platform featuring powerful signal processing capabilities, offering roll-stabilised bathymetry and several types of imagery and backscatter output. With broad R&D expertise, NORBIT has developed, from the ground up, an exciting new technology that allows existing and new applications to benefit from the advantages offered by a compact wideband curved-array Multibeam sonar.
